Systems Engineering consists of two significant disciplines: the technical knowledge domain in which the systems engineer operates, and systems engineering management. This book focuses on both with equal treatment. The main feature of the book is blending traditional systems engineering with application to the Department of Defense (DoD) Adaptive Acquisition Pathway, a recent and major change to DoDs acquisition of new systems. Holistically, the book treats the technical systems engineering processes , the project processes or control processes, and the acquisition processes as integral parts. In addition, the organizational processes that enable systems engineering-the enterprise processes-as well as the as well as agreement process through which user/stakeholder requirements are established. are considered.
